The Black Hamptons has a season 2 return date. The series based on the novel by The New York Times best-selling author Carl Weber will be back on BET+ Dec. 7.
The family drama set in Sag Harbor will welcome several new cast members including Richard Lawson, Steven Williams, RonReaco Lee, Blue Kimble, Niki Taylor, and Thomas Calabro, among others.
The Black Hamptons highlights the glitz and gloss of the Black elite while following the lives of the Brittons and the Johnsons and exposing the secrets of wealth and prestige. With a mix of legacy families, their friends, wannabes and thirsty developers, the drama in Sag Harbor is never too far behind. Lamman Rucker, Vanessa Bell Calloway, Elise Neal, Brian White, KaRon Riley, Mike Merrill, Angela ‘Blac Chyna’ White, Aaron Spears, Daya Vaidya, Cameo Sherrell and Jennifer Freeman will all reprise their roles from season one.

BET has set a new four-part original limited series, Carl Weber’s The Black Hamptons, from The New York Times best-selling author of the same name and the executive producers of the popular BET+ original drama, The Family Business.
The show is a new family drama set in the quaint town of Sag Harbor, known as “The Black Hamptons,” in Long Island, NY. From luxury communities to historic beachfront enclaves, the story will follow the brewing feud between the ‘Brittons’ and the ‘Johnsons,’ where the difference between old and new money is very apparent.
The cast includes Lamman Rucker, Vanessa Bell Calloway, Elise Neal, Brian White, Karon Riley, Mike Merrill, Blac Chyna, Aaron Spears, Daya Vaidya, Cameo Sherrell, Franklin Ojeda Smith, Jordan Smith, Jennifer Freeman, and David Andrews. The series will make its BET debut in Summer 2022.

HBO, Rai and Fremantle have announced the renewal of drama series “My Brilliant Friend” for a third season, titled “My Brilliant Friend: Those Who Leave and Those Who Stay.” Just like the previous two seasons were inspired by the first two books in Elena Ferrante‘s four-part book series of the same name, Season 3 will be based on the third book in it. Filmed in Italian, “My Brilliant Friend” follows Elena Greco, played by Margherita Mazzucco and her friend Lila Cerullo, played by Gaia Girace, throughout the 60 years of their complicated and mysterious friendship. NBA Player Accuses Wife of Vicious Attack
NBA veteran Earl Watson has filed for divorce from his wife Jennifer Freeman -- claiming the "My Wife and Kids" actress attacked him in a late night rage ... and savagely bit him on the chest until he bled.
According to legal papers filed last week in L.A. County Superior Court, Watson claims things got bad on August 1st ... when Jennifer received a suspicious text message at 11Pm and Earl decided to check her phone.
Watson -- who played with the Indiana Pacers last season -- claims his wife was furious that he took the phone and reacted by hitting him "forcefully twice in the face with her right open hand."
Watson claims Jennifer then "grabbed my right wrist and bit ... breaking the skin, leaving teeth marks and drawing blood." Once she let go of the wrist, Watson claims she then chomped down...

Assembling this vehicle for his young clients, music producer/manager/video director Christopher B. Stokes has attached an anemic plot to a series of dynamic hip-hop dance sequences. The target audience of young MTV watchers, in particular fans of R&B acts B2K and IMx, might overlook the dramatic weaknesses of You Got Served and buy into the protagonists' dreams of fame, fortune and showbiz salvation. Moderate boxoffice returns are in store before the dance-off to home video.
Writer-director Stokes wastes no time getting down to business, with a rousing credits-sequence dance battle between two crews. Cheered on by kids packed to the rafters in a Los Angeles warehouse, the troupes vying for the $600 prize display outstanding athleticism in their aggressive, witty style of street dancing. Refereeing the competitions is Mr. Rad (Steve Harvey), who dispenses prize money and fatherly advice.
The leaders of the winning crew, best friends Elgin (Marques Houston of IMx) and David (Omari Grandberry, aka Omarion, formerly of hip-hop group B2K), have their sights on the big time. So when they receive a $5,000 challenge from Orange County, Calif., rich boy Wade (Christopher Jones), they go for it, even if they and their crew (played by Jarell Houston, DeMario Thornton and Dreux Frederic, the remaining members of B2K) have to pool everything they have.
After withstanding betrayals and threats from outside, the two friends come to blows when David starts dating Elgin's younger sister, Liyah (Jennifer Freeman of ABCs My Wife and Kids). The brooding, protective Elgin, who considers David a player, stops speaking to both of them, and as the plot rounds a few melodramatic turns, the two friends form separate crews for a high-stakes MTV contest, the Big Bounce, which carries a prize of $50,000 and the chance to dance in a Lil' Kim video.
For all its upbeat aphorisms about self-respect, perseverance and loyalty, Stokes' script has a curiously neutral take on the shady dealings of Emerald (Michael Bear Taliferro), who operates an unspecified business from a smoky bar, with David and Elgin freelancing for him as couriers. It's clear that the backpacks they transport aren't full of Girl Scout cookies. Their reluctance to continue working for Emerald, counterbalanced by their ambitions and their families' needs, is presented in a refreshing matter-of-fact way, although the plot strand is tied up far too neatly.
Though the film is filled with supporting roles straight out of central casting -- the mouthy best girlfriend (Meagan Good), the feisty grandmother (Esther Scott), the eager young mascot Malcolm David Kelley) -- the cast generally drives home the cliche-ridden themes with heart. Real-life brothers Houston and Grandberry are especially charismatic, playing off their characters' contrasting intensity and playfulness.
With its competitive edge, Served offers a more hardcore look at hip-hop dance than the recent Honey. And though its dance battles become repetitive, Stokes and choreographers Dave Scott and Shane Sparks, supported by DP David Hennings, editor Earl Watson, an able design team and a pounding soundtrack, fashion a suitably climactic five-minute showdown to close the story.
